## Changelog — Ticktrace 1.9

### Renamed: DRIFT_API_TOKEN
During the cron drift investigation we found plugins confusing this variable with the metrics token, so it has been renamed to indicate it authorizes drift-report uploads specifically. Plugin authors must read the new name from 1.9 onward; the old name is ignored without warning. Sample env files in the SDK are updated. In your deployment env file, the drift-report upload secret is set on the next line.

env line for fawef-taguf: VAULT_KEY13=a9695905a9a90

Subject: Partner SFTP drop — new owner

Hi,

As you review the pending changes to the Harborline ingest scripts, note that ownership of the partner SFTP drop is changing at the end of the month. This includes key rotation, the nightly pull job, and the quarantine folder for malformed files. Review comments on the retry logic should still go through the normal PR flow, but questions about drop-folder conventions or partner onboarding now go to the new owner. The incoming owner is listed below.

signatory, tagaf-bahaf: Praael Fenmir Rusok

### Log sampling on Pipewren

When Pipewren floods the aggregator, enable sampling via the admin API rather than restarting the service. Set sample_rate to 0.1 for bursts, restore to 1.0 afterward, and note the change in the ops journal. The sampling endpoint requires authentication; use the bearer token below.

bearer token for kawig-yajef: eyJhbGciOiJIUzI1NiIsInR5cCI6IkpXVCJ9.eyJzdWIiOiI8HQhnz97dxIn0.tsXu5Xf2tmo0